The Cultural Politics of Opera, 1720-1742 : The Era of Walpole, Pope, and Handel.
McGeary, Thomas.Woodbridge: Boydell & Brewer ©2024
This book explores the intersection of opera, literature, and partisan politics, and demonstrates how Italian opera was used by the British political elite in the culture wars of the day. With a preface, bibliography, and index. Plates and tables.
